관련 링크 : http://kldp.org/node/96019 실험코드 #include #include class CBase { public: CBase() : a(0) { } public: virtual void Test(void) { for(int i = 0; i < 10; ++i) { a = i; } } void Test2(void) { for(int i = 0; i < 10; ++i) { a = i; } } protected: int a; private: CBase(const CBase& rhs); CBase operator=(const CBase& rhs); }; class CDerived : public CBase { public: virtual void Test(void) { for(int ..
실험 검색 결과
해당 글 2건
가상함수 Vs 비가상 함수 Vs 전역함수 의 함수 호출 비용 비교
연구실/파편화된 기록들
2008. 7. 15. 06:23
for Vs while 의 반복 비용 비교
Purpose-built post 왜 이런 생각을 하게 되었냐면, .. KGCA15기 프로그래밍반 짝궁인 선호가 루프를 돌릴때 for을 사용 하여 for(;;;) 을 쓰길래, 왜 그렇게 쓰는지 물어 보니.. .. 명서인 "C programing language"에는 모두 이렇게 되어 있더라. 라고 말해 주었다.. 혹시나 해서.. 집에와 MSVC2005 로 어샘블리어 비교를 하기 시작하여, 그 결과를 올리게 된다. Content 결론을 내기전에 우선 두가지 측면에서 while과 for을 봐야한다. 우선 조건이 있는 루프를 돌때 예(while(비교), for(;비교;)) 1. 조건문이 있는 while과 for 문 비교 while unsigned int i = -1, j = 0; while(j < i) { +..
연구실/파편화된 기록들
2008. 7. 3. 02:15
최근댓글